Adan Canto, the beloved Mexican singer and actor celebrated for his roles in iconic productions like “X-Men: Days of Future Past,” “Designated Survivor,” and “The Cleaning Lady,” has passed away at the age of 42 due to appendiceal cancer. His publicist, Jennifer Allen, conveyed the sad news, emphasizing Adan’s decision to keep his health battle private.

Known for his diverse talents, Adan’s career began at the age of 16 when he ventured from his home in Ciudad Acuna, Coahuila, Mexico, to Mexico City to pursue his dream of becoming a singer-songwriter. This marked the beginning of a remarkable journey that later led him to the world of acting. Adan made his TV debut in 2009 on the Mexican series “Estado de Gracia” before achieving recognition on the international stage with his American debut in Kevin Williamson’s 2013 Fox drama series “The Following.”

Adan Canto: A Tapestry of Talent and Versatility

Adan Canto’s notable roles include Vice President-elect Aaron Shore in “Designated Survivor,” Colombian politician Rodrigo Lara Bonilla in “Narcos,” and the mutant Sunspot in “X-Men: Days of Future Past.”

His contributions extended to Halle Berry’s directorial debut, “Bruised,” and “Agent Game.” Adan’s directorial talents were also showcased in his two short films, the first in 2014 and the second in 2020, a western featuring Theo Rossi.

At the time of his passing, Adan was playing Armand Morales on Fox’s “The Cleaning Lady,” currently filming its third season.

Unfortunately, his illness prevented his active participation, though he harbored hopes of rejoining the cast later in the season.

Adan Canto’s vibrant personality, characterized by a broad smile and a contagious laugh, concealed a sensitivity and humility that endeared him to friends and colleagues.

Kiefer Sutherland, who worked alongside Adan in “Designated Survivor,” expressed his heartfelt tribute, lamenting the loss of a wonderful spirit and a dedicated actor. Adan is survived by his wife, Stephanie Ann Canto, and their two young children, Roman Alder and Eve Josephine.
